A two-day Volleyball Tournament organised by Noney Battalion of Assam Rifles under the aegis of Headquarters 21 Sector Assam Rifles and Inspector General of Assam Rifles (East) concluded at Veitum Khullen Village in Kangpokpi district on Monday.

Noney Battalion, Assam Rifles bagged the first prize whereas S Saheibung Youth Club stood runner-up after a nerve-wrecking final match that was played between the two top teams of the tournament.

The tournament was organised to promote the 'Fit India Movement' and 'Khelo India Campaign' and also to strengthen the bond of affinity between the forces and local populace.

The event also focused to inspire the youth towards sports. Players and others supporters present were also educated on the role of sports in human development and various career opportunities in the field of sports, both in forces and outside were also discussed in detail. A total of six teams participated and they were felicitated at the closing ceremony.
